verb
- past tense and past participle of regrant; to grant again or anew
Usage: legal; formal
Examples
- The patent was regranted after the initial application was corrected.
- The city council regranted the business license following the appeal.
- His citizenship was regranted after the legal error was discovered.
- The university regranted her scholarship for the following semester.
- The land rights were regranted to the original owners.
- The permit was regranted once all safety requirements were met.
